Tiger Thoughts - Part 1
Posted by Sandy
Another cat, another series of predictable headlines.
This week's release of Tiger (a.k.a. Mac OS X version 10.4) is bound to unleash (sorry) a new litter of cat-related headline puns.
Watch for:
- Apple Changes Its Stripes
- Apple Has Tiger By the Tail
- Tiger on the Prowl
- Tiger No Pussycat
- Tiger is Grrrreat!
Will Apple stick with the predator cat theme for future releases? Unfortunately, they're running out of Big Cats. Future releases may include OS X Lion, Bobcat (Lynx), Cheetah, and my personal favorite: Ocelot.
